The United States Combined Heat and Power Systems Market refers to the economic sector within the U.S. that involves the production and utilization of combined heat and power (CHP) systems. These systems, also known as cogeneration, simultaneously generate electricity and useful heat from the same energy source. The market encompasses various technologies and applications aimed at enhancing energy efficiency and sustainability in the country.

In 2022, the total market value of global United States Combined Heat and Power Systems Market reached USD 25 billion. Anticipated to exhibit significant growth, it is projected to exceed USD 44.56 billion by 2030, demonstrating a compound annual growth rate (CAGR) of 6% from 2023 to 2030.

Key Players Driving Innovation in the U.S. Combined Heat and Power Systems Market

The key players in the U.S. Combined Heat and Power Systems Market include industry leaders and innovators driving advancements in sustainable energy solutions. Prominent companies shaping the market landscape include General Electric Company, Siemens AG, Caterpillar Inc., Capstone Turbine Corporation, ABB Ltd, Cummins Inc., Mitsubishi Hitachi Power Systems, Schneider Electric SE, Veolia Environnement S.A., and 2G Energy AG. These entities play pivotal roles in the development, manufacturing, and deployment of cutting-edge combined heat and power technologies, contributing significantly to the markets growth and evolution.
